This guide walks you through everything you need to know to buy ICX with confidence.<\/p>\n<h2>What Is ICON?<\/h2>\n<p>ICON is a Layer 1 blockchain platform founded in 2017 with a mission that goes beyond just running smart contracts \u2014 it&#8217;s built to solve one of the most persistent headaches in crypto: getting different blockchains to actually work together reliably. Cross-chain development sounds straightforward in theory, but in practice it involves serious tradeoffs around security, speed, and scalability. ICON&#8217;s Cross-Chain Framework was designed specifically to reduce that friction, giving developers a cleaner path to building applications that operate across multiple chains without the usual engineering nightmares.<\/p>\n<p>What sets ICON apart is its long-term commitment to cross-chain infrastructure at a time when most projects were focused solely on their own ecosystems. Rather than treating interoperability as an afterthought, ICON made it central to the platform&#8217;s identity. Applications built on ICON can gain cross-chain functionality while maintaining momentum and building a reputation across a broader user base.<\/p>\n<p>ICON also has a governance layer, meaning ICX token holders have a say in the direction of the network. The project has attracted backing from notable names in the space, including Pantera Capital, which adds a layer of credibility to its long-term development roadmap. For developers and users who care about a connected, multi-chain future, ICON offers a mature and purpose-built foundation.<\/p>\n<h2>Why Buy ICX?<\/h2>\n<p>There are a few reasons people take a closer look at ICX when building out their crypto portfolios or exploring the ecosystem.<\/p>\n<p>First, ICON has been around since 2017, which is significant in a space where most projects fade quickly. That kind of support tends to attract developer interest and longer-term ecosystem growth, which many investors see as a positive signal when evaluating a project.<\/p>\n<h3>What is ICON and how does it work?<\/h3>\n<p>ICON is a Layer 1 blockchain platform built to make cross-chain development simpler and more secure. At its core, it provides infrastructure that lets decentralized applications operate across multiple blockchains without developers having to rebuild everything from scratch for each chain. ICX is the native token used for transactions, staking, and governance on the network. Think of ICON as a bridge-builder in the crypto world \u2014 its goal is to make different blockchain ecosystems talk to each other more smoothly.<\/p>\n<h3>Where is the best place to buy ICX?<\/h3>\n<p>ICX is available on Binance, Bybit, and Gate.io, all of which are well-established exchanges with solid reputations.
